TikTok announced several features that will be added to the social network soon, and one of them caught the attention of teen users as the app will limit their screen time to one hour per day. This is simply one of the features that is added to improve the well-being of its youngest users and is the most striking of those that were announced.
Starting in the next few weeks, those who have a TikTok and are under 18 years they are going to have a screen time limit of one hour. This will be automatically applied and renewed every day, and if the limit is reached, a window will appear asking the teenager for a password. Something interesting is that you can disable this function, but if you exceed 100 minutes viewed, the application will ask you to set a new limit, as well as the password.

As confirmed by the social network, these indications increased the use of its screen time management tools in a 2. 3. 4 % during the first month of trial. Teens will receive a notification in their inbox each week summarizing their screen time, letting them know how much time they’re using the app. To influence users to increase their screen time, TikTok it will require them to make active decisions, although they did not give any examples to clarify what it is.
This function will also be available in the version of the social network for younger users, which is aimed exclusively at under 13. In this case, a parent or guardian will have to link the accounts of the young people to theirs and configure the password in case they exceed the daily time. The time added is only 30 minutes and it cannot extend more than that.

In addition to this function, four others were added for the Family Pairingwhich are the parental controls of TikTok exclusive to those who linked their children’s accounts to theirs. For example, you can modify the time limit and set a different time for each of the weekdays. And one of the most important additions is being able to filter the videos that the minors we are in charge see and prevent them from seeing some of them.
